We’ll see Edmund McMillen and Florian Himsl’s The Binding of Isaac return again on the GTA VI release day with a new Repentance + Online Switch 2, PS5, and Xbox Series X debut. It will show up on November 19, 2026. This is a version that includes every additional content update for the game and online multiplayer. Digital copies will be available for all consoles, but only a Switch 2 $69.99 physical copy will appear.
The Binding of Isaac first appeared in September 2011 on PCs and got a Wrath of the Lamb expansion. That was followed by the Rebirth port in 2014, an Afterbirth update, and more recently a Repentance release. The tenth anniversary Repentance + update appeared in December 2024 for PCs and marked the debut of online multiplayer. While the base Repentance release did appear on consoles before, this marks the first online multiplayer release for the platforms.

The preliminary art for the Switch 2 physical copy appeared too. That doesn’t feature the trademark game key card disclaimer, so it looks like we’ll be getting the full game on the cartridge for this release.

The Binding of Isaac Repentance + Online will appear on the Switch 2, PS5, and Xbox Series X on November 19, 2026, sharing a release day with GTA VI.
